The host Calaveras Redskins softball team prevailed 4-2 over Linden on Tuesday in a battle of Mother Lode Legue unbeatens. The Summerville Bears suffered a 6-1 road loss to Argonaut on Tuesday. Courtney Robinson had both of Summerville’s hits, one a double. The Bears run was scored by Breann Robinson who reached base on a walk. “We just didn’t hit the ball very well,” said Bears assistant coach Ray Emerald. “We under-achieved. Errors (four total) were a problem for us today.”

The Bullfrogs trounced Amador 20-1 on Tuesday in Angels Camp. As a team, Bret Harte went 12 for 24 with 16 RBIs. Leading the way for the offense was Bekka Gross and Lauren Lane. Gross went a perfect 3 for 3 with a home run and four runs scored and four runs driven in. Lane also belted a home run and went 2 for 3 with five RBIs. Also for Bret Harte (3-3, 1-2 MLL), Cassidy Davis went 2 for 4 with a triple and three RBIs, Keryn Thompson went 2 for 2 with two runs scored, Kaielin Gilliland smacked a double and scored three runs and CJ Cobb had a double. Taylor O’Connor started in the circle for Bret Harte and threw four no-hit innings, striking our four and walking two. She picked up her third victory of the season.
